Biography of R.K. Narayan

(October 10, 1906 - May 13, 2001)

R.K. Narayan is a very popular name in English literature not only in India but the world over. He was born on October 10, 1906 in Kerala. After completing his studies he joined a high school and became a teacher. However, he desired to become a writer.

He had a great fascination for children and their activities. So, a majority of books written by him are associated with children. Some of his well-acclaimed books are 'Swami and friends', 'Malgudi Days', 'The English Teacher', 'The Ramayan', 'The financial Expert', etc.

In the book "Malgudi Days', a T.V. serial was made which became very popular among children. His book "The Guide was so much appreciated the world over that a play was organised at both Cambridge and Oxford University He visited the Philippines to write the biography of Raman Magsaysay. The Indian government honoured him with the Sahitya Academy Award and the Padma Bhushan. He was also once nominated as a member of the Rajya Sabha in the Parliament. He passed away on May 13, 2001.
